About this route:
A direct, nonstop flight between Greater Cumberland Regional Airport (CBE), Cumberland, Maryland, United States and Chatham-Kent Airport (XCM), Chatham-Kent, Ontario, Canada would travel a Great Circle distance of 254 miles (or 409 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Greater Cumberland Regional Airport and Chatham-Kent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Greater Cumberland Regional Airport (CBE):
- On the second level of the airport terminal is the Cohongaronta Gallery with an array of displays on the history of the Potomac Highlands area.
- The closest airport to Greater Cumberland Regional Airport (CBE) is Eastern WV Regional Airport (MRB), which is located 44 miles (71 kilometers) ESE of CBE.
- Because of Greater Cumberland Regional Airport's relatively low elevation of 775 feet, planes can take off or land at Greater Cumberland Regional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- Greater Cumberland Regional Airport (CBE) has 2 runways.
- The furthest airport from Greater Cumberland Regional Airport (CBE) is Margaret River Airport (MGV), which is located 11,576 miles (18,630 kilometers) away in Margaret River, Western Australia, Australia.
